Pronunciation
noun
Yes; an answer that shows agreement or acceptance.
"10-4 good buddy. That's an affirmative - the tractor trailer is in the ditch at the side of the highway."
noun
(grammar) An answer that shows agreement or acceptance.
noun
An assertion.
adjective
Pertaining to truth; asserting that something is; affirming
"an affirmative answer"
adjective
Pertaining to any assertion or active confirmation that favors a particular result
adjective
Positive
"an affirmative vote"
adjective
Confirmative; ratifying.
"an act affirmative of common law"
adjective
Dogmatic
adjective
Expressing the agreement of the two terms of a proposition.
adjective
Positive; not negative
interjection
An elaborate synonym for the word yes.
interjection
(especially radio communications) Yes; true; correct.
